I've had a less than desirable life. Kids at my school complain when their parents refuse them the smallest things. They take their nice, warm houses for granted; they take their good food for granted; they take hot water and regular electricity and WiFi and all their friends and family for granted. They take their good health and all their senses for granted. They take love for granted. They don't know how lucky they are. I do.
